IT Hardware Technician

Overview:
Planned Systems International (PSI) is an Enterprise IT services company who focuses on designing, building, securing, and operating cutting-edge software solutions that drive mission success and operational excellence for Federal Government organizations. We are currently seeking an IT Hardware Technician who will be part of a dynamic team that provides IT repair, maintenance, operations, logistics, and engineering services to help ensure secure, reliable, and uninterrupted availability of Endpoint IT Systems.

Essential Functions and

Job Responsibilities:

  • Troubleshoot and resolve common hardware and network issues including video cards, desktop/laptop issues, cabling and physical layer networking issues, and printer troubleshooting and/or maintenance.
  • Diagnose and resolve problems with desktop systems, printers, digital senders, mobile devices and other standard office equipment.
  • Complete basic hardware work as directed, such as cable management, desktop PC installation, monitors, KVM's, and laptop imaging and issuance.
  • Provide input and update to standard operating procedures.
  • Conduct validation of ticket information to ensure completeness and accuracy and escalate issues via ticketing system and requests for assistance as needed.
  • Participate in/lead special projects and day‐to‐day operations.
  • Consistently remain customer focused and provide a high level of customer service.
  • Interact daily with supervisor, peers, and customers and provide polite and friendly customer service.
  • Other duties may be assigned to meet business needs.

Minimum Requirements:

  • Active T3 investigation, with the ability to obtain and maintain necessary security clearances as required for access to classified information.
  • DoD 8140 IAT Level II certification (e.g. CompTIA Security+ CE).

Desired

Qualifications:

  • 8+ years of relevant professional experience

Physical Demands:

  • Walking to multiple offices at the customer site to survey and deliver replacement hardware (desktops and laptops).
